The antivert (meclizine) is available over the counter as Bonine motion sickness medication. It never helped me with vertigo or dizziness - even though that's what they had me try it for. The only thing that has really helped is Klonipin and an added bonus is that it also helps with the spasticity, so it supplements the Baclofen for me.
